Understand the wireless market and how vendors are working with the new specification - Wi-Fi 6. This book provides valuable insights for both technical teams and stakeholders, covering the benefits and market vision for the Campus Area. 


Beginning with the basics of RF and Wi-Fi Standards, we illustrate the impact on technology and configuration, extending beyond device introductions to focus on customer benefits and enhanced experiences. Moving into a market recap, we address the mix of old and new devices, emphasizing the importance of comprehensive reviews before replacements. We offer an agnostic comparison of specifications between vendors and explore the influence of AI and ML on device enhancement and cost reduction. 


Returning to technical aspects, topics include optimizing Signal Strength, utilizing 802.11v for better client paths, and ensuring low latency for customers. The book then explores wireless client traffic categorization, examining QoS configurations, end-to-end QoS, and dedicated communication channels. A final focus on SD-WAN provides a comprehensive review of its impact and the necessary configurations. Cisco Wireless Campus bridges the gap between technical and business aspects, offering a holistic perspective uncommon in existing resources.
